Wow folks, I can't believe your mileage ***** so bad! I just gave up YJ's after driving them for 11 years for a liberty because of fuel economy. I used to get on average 12mpg in the YJ, and I'm almos doubling that in my nused KJ. I don't know why you all are getting such poor fuel economy??? Enginewise I'm all stock for the moment, but I'm sporting a 2.5" lift and 31's (sniffle I miss my 35's), and ARB bump w/ a Warn winch. I just drove from Colorado Springs to Telluride this past weekend with 2 bikes on top, and loaded down for a weekend of camping, and I was still pulling 21MPG. That's also including several major Mt. passes. Now a big seller for my KJ was the 5 spd manual, but still I got a huge gap in the milage compared to what you folks are claiming!
